Offered only on HD + and xprv wallets holding more than one address: the last address of a wallet + is never removable, and a key wallet has exactly one. +- **Elements**: + - "Back" button, "Remove Address" heading + - The address's own label ("Address N") and its wallet's name + - The full address (color dot, etherscan link, tap to copy), with the ENS + name above it if resolved + - Explanation that this only stops the wallet tracking the address: nothing + is destroyed, no key is deleted, funds stay where they are, and the + address comes back by importing the recovery phrase again + - A line naming the address's ETH balance when it holds one, stating that + removal moves and spends nothing. A balance is a warning, never a refusal. + - The rule that a wallet always keeps at least one address, and that + removing the last one means deleting the wallet from Settings + - Error line + - "Remove Address" button +- **Transitions**: + - "Remove Address" → removes the address and its site permissions, then → + previous screen (Home) with an "Address removed." flash message + - "Back" → previous screen (Home), nothing removed +- **Deliberately not password-gated**, unlike DeleteWallet: a password gates the + disclosure or destruction of a secret, and this does neither. The address + stays derivable from key material the wallet still holds. +- The active address moves only if it was the address removed, and then to the + wallet's first remaining address, with `AUTISTMASK_ACTIVE_CHANGED` broadcast + so a connected site stops being told about an address the user removed + (`src/shared/walletDelete.js`). A selection in any other wallet is left alone; + one in this wallet follows the splice. +- The wallet's derivation counter (`nextIndex`) is not rewound, so "+" derives a + fresh address rather than handing back the one just removed. + #### SettingsAddToken (`settings-addtoken`) - **When**: User tapped "+ Add token" in Settings.
